    Re: Emerald tree boa help!!

    Quote Originally Posted by hhw View Post
    A freshly wild caught snake being docile could mean that you got lucky with his temperament, or it could mean that he's too weak to exhibit his natural temperament.
    I was thinking the same thing about being weak. I hope that is not the case but from what I know about wild caught GTP and ETB they are not usually little sweethearts. I was first thinking because of the snakes temperament that it could not be a wild caught....I should have asked. Good call hhw.

    OP, I think the vet is a really good idea as is biting the bullet and making the proper cage happen now.
